Abstract The polarographic diffusion current of some tervalent substitution-inert complex cations decreases by the addition of sulfate. From the change in diffusion current the association constants of substitution-inert complex and sulfate ions are obtained at ionic strength 0.1 (NaClO4) and 25°C. The values are 69±8, 58±8 and 4×10 for [Co(NH3)6]3+–SO42−, [Cr(NH3)6]3+–SO42− and [Cr(H2O)6]3+–SO42 respectively. The formation of [Co(NH3)6]3+–HSO4− is negligibly small compared with that of [Co(NH3)6]3+–SO42−.
